Transaction 7f708febd0e8dededb85fea191f7abf95756f96a5564951c5316889fc0540ea3
1 Input
1 Output
-
7f708febd0e8dededb85fea191f7abf95756f96a5564951c5316889fc0540ea3:0
- value
- 438271
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d59294e742595f734cb8a0968652d3d04f1c1f4b OP_EQUAL
- address
- 3MAHT5LBVNF6geKGaqvh3K4QiWYQfk7JQX